ICON shares up 4% on profit leap

SHARES in ICON rose by nearly 4% in early trading yesterday after the group said net profits rose by 46% in 2007.

ICON, which tests and researches drugs and equipment for pharmaceutical and medical device firms, saw profits rise to $55.9 million (€37.7m) from $38m in the previous year.

Revenues for the year rose by 38% to $630m and the company said it won $344m of new business in the final quarter of 2007.
